Here are some   updates on recent health and nutrition findings: Veggies improve dining experience According to researchers at Cornell University, adding veggies to your meal will improve your perception of dishes (compared to those served without vegetables) as well as your attitude toward the cook. “The results showed that meals were favored when a vegetable was included, such as steak vs. steak with broccoli, but also received better descriptions such as 'loving' for the same meal. They also chose much more positive descriptors for the meal preparer that served a vegetable, including much more frequent selection of 'thoughtful,' 'attentive' and 'capable,' accompanied by a decrease in the selections of 'neglectful,' 'selfish' and 'boring.'” So make sure to include vegetables in all your meals.
